Tips For Ensuring Your Ipad Passes Amazon’S Trade-In Quality Check

When trading in your iPad on Amazon, ensuring it passes their quality check is essential to receive the best possible trade-in value. Proper preparation can make the process smoother and increase your chances of approval.

Understand Amazon’s Trade-In Requirements

Before you start, familiarize yourself with Amazon’s trade-in criteria. Amazon typically requires devices to be in good condition, fully functional, and with minimal cosmetic damage. The device should power on, and all features should work properly.

Clean Your iPad Thoroughly

A clean device not only looks better but also indicates good maintenance. Use a soft, lint-free cloth to wipe the screen, back, and edges. Avoid harsh chemicals that could damage the surface. Remove any dirt, fingerprints, or smudges.

Check for Physical Damage

Inspect your iPad for scratches, dents, or cracks. Repair minor cosmetic damages if possible, as excessive damage can lead to rejection. Replace a cracked screen or damaged casing if feasible, as these are common reasons for rejection.

Ensure Full Functionality

Test all features of your iPad thoroughly. Confirm that the touchscreen responds accurately, the camera works, speakers and microphone are functional, and buttons are responsive. Connect to Wi-Fi and ensure the device powers on and off correctly.

Reset and Remove Personal Data

Perform a complete reset to erase all personal information. Backup important data beforehand. Sign out of iCloud, iTunes, and other accounts. Restoring to factory settings ensures your device is clean and ready for trade-in.

Gather Accessories and Original Packaging

If possible, include original packaging, chargers, and accessories. Devices with original accessories are often valued higher and more likely to pass quality checks.

Take Clear Photos

Capture high-quality images of your iPad from multiple angles. Clear photos help demonstrate the device’s condition and can support your claim if any questions arise during the process.

Follow Amazon’s Submission Instructions Carefully

Accurately fill out all required information during the trade-in process. Double-check details such as model number, condition, and accessories included. Providing precise information reduces delays and increases approval chances.

Additional Tips for Success

  • Keep your device charged during the process to avoid any power-related issues.
  • Be honest about the condition to prevent rejection due to misrepresentation.
  • Review Amazon’s trade-in policies periodically for updates.
